New York City is home to more than 1,550 active fintech startups and 54 fintech unicorns, spanning payments, wealthtech, insurtech, lending, and regtech. The top 60 ranked companies alone have raised $16.9 billion between them, and most sit at Series A or Series B stage — the city’s fintech scene is past the early-bet phase and into scaling mode.

Who’s Leading the 2026 Ranking

Kalshi, iCapital Network, and Vestwell lead New York’s 2026 fintech ranking. Kalshi runs a federally regulated prediction market, letting users trade on the outcome of real-world events. iCapital Network builds the technology infrastructure that connects financial advisors and their clients to alternative investments like private equity and hedge funds — a category institutional money has been moving into aggressively. Vestwell provides the retirement-plan infrastructure that powers workplace savings programs for employers who don’t want to build 401(k) systems themselves.

Where the Money Is Moving

Global fintech venture funding climbed 27% in 2025 to $51.8 billion, and New York captured a disproportionate share of that growth. City fintech deal value rose to $6.71 billion in 2024 before climbing further through 2025 as AI-native financial tools started pulling in institutional capital rather than just consumer app funding. The pattern in 2026 rounds: AI-driven underwriting and compliance tools, crypto-native banking infrastructure, and AI agent platforms built specifically for banks and asset managers, replacing what used to be manual back-office work.

That’s a shift from the last fintech wave, which was mostly about consumer-facing apps — budgeting tools, neobanks, payment apps. The 2026 money is going toward infrastructure that sits behind the scenes at banks, asset managers, and insurers, doing the compliance, underwriting, and operations work that used to require large back-office teams.
